본문 바로가기

# 02/Python

추상화 TIP

반응형
# 다음 두 줄은 같다
x = x + 1
x += 1

x = x + 2
x += 2

x = x * 2
x *= 2

x = x - 3
x -= 3

x = x / 2
x /= 2

x = x % 7
x %= 7



파라미터 기본값 지정 가능

(단, 항상 기본값 지정한 파라미터는 마지막에 두어야 함!!)

def myself(name, age, nationality = "한국"):
    print("내 이름은 %s" % name)
    print("나이는 %d살" % age)
    print("국적은 %s" % nationality)

myself("조이", 1)            # 기본값이 설정된 파라미터를 바꾸지 않을 때
myself("조이", 1, "미국")     # 기본값이 설정된 파라미터를 바꾸었을 때


반응형

'# 02 > Python' 카테고리의 다른 글

문법  (0) 2019.03.07
codeanywhere 설정  (0) 2019.03.06
함수  (0) 2019.03.05
자료형 TIP  (0) 2019.03.03
자료형(Data Type)  (0) 2019.03.03